What Hurricane Roof Repair Work Involves
Hurricane roof repairs encompass the full range of restoration work completed on a roof after storm-related damage. This covers everything from repairing torn flashing to addressing compromised roof decking. The complexity of repairs depends heavily on how directly your home was hit, the condition of the roof prior to impact, and which roofing systems were in place.
Residents in coastal areas should understand that hurricane roof repairs are not identical from home to home. A flat membrane roof demands a very different set of techniques than a concrete tile installation. Trained contractors at STS Impact Windows & Doors apply material-specific knowledge to every project so that solutions applied last long-term.
Hurricane roof repairs frequently are tied to the claims and reimbursement cycle. A large number of South Florida residents carry wind or hurricane insurance policies that help pay for a considerable amount of restoration expenses. Partnering with a contractor who knows how to navigate the documentation and evidence standards for insurance claims makes a real difference in significant out-of-pocket expense.

- Temporary Weatherproofing and Stabilization — Rapid deployment of heavy-duty tarps over breached or compromised roofing areas to prevent further interior flooding while scheduled repair work are arranged.
- Structural Decking Review and Replacement — Detailed evaluation of the underlying roof deck for rot, delamination, or hurricane-driven compromise, followed by precise decking restoration.
- Metal Panel and Roofing Material Replacement — Matching and replacing torn, shattered, or dislodged roofing materials using code-compliant materials that satisfy updated Florida Building Code wind resistance requirements.
- Hip and Ridge Restoration and Resealing — Reattaching or replacing ridge cap shingles or tiles that blow off during storm conditions, eliminating one of the most common leak sources across the roofline.
- Transition Sealing and Waterproofing — Reseating or renewing corroded, pulled-away, or damaged metal flashing near vent pipes, chimneys, and roof-to-wall junctions to re-establish a continuous moisture barrier.
- Roofline Trim and Gutter Repair — Fixing or renewing detached soffit sections, broken fascia, and bent or separated gutters that are critical in channeling rainwater from your home's foundation and walls.
- Rooftop Ventilation Component Repair — Checking and repairing turbine vents, ridge vents, and airflow structures damaged during the storm to ensure balanced moisture control after restoration.

Frequently Asked Questions About Hurricane Roof Repairs
Here are some of the most common questions we receive about hurricane roof repairs:
How much does hurricane roof repairs typically cost?Pricing for hurricane roof repairs differ significantly depending on how much of the roof was affected. Small-scale work — including fixing isolated tiles and resealing penetrations — might run between $500 and $2,000. Significant damage involving decking or framing often falls in the range of tens of thousands for severe cases. A large percentage of claimants learn their wind or hurricane insurance pays for significant parts of eligible work.
How long does hurricane roof repairs usually require?Timeline varies based on how much damage exists. Minor material replacement may be wrapped up quickly, while larger projects involving decking replacement or material replacement throughout may require a week or more subject to material availability, permit timelines, and contractor availability in your area.
Do homeowners have to leave during hurricane roof repairs?In most cases, homeowners can remain — standard restoration projects won't force leaving your home. However, if damage is severe and the interior is open to weather, our team will recommend staying elsewhere until your home can be safely occupied again.
What separates storm stabilization and long-term hurricane roof repairs?Emergency repairs — including boarding and waterproof sheeting — are designed to stop immediate water intrusion before undergoing permanent hurricane roof repairs. Full restoration work involve carrying out code-compliant, inspected construction and restoring the roof to its original or improved design performance. We always recommend following up temporary protection with complete restoration before the next storm season.
How do I know if my roof needs full replacement or just targeted hurricane roof repairs?This is one of the most critical determinations following a storm. When a roof have significant remaining useful life and limited affected area benefit most from selective restoration. Older roofs with widespread damage are often better served by complete system removal and reinstallation.
